TPCC Chief Revanth Reddy has been quite critical of chief minister KCR’s tactics. Especially, in the last few months, Revanth has been quite bold with his allegations and criticism against the half-boiled welfare schemes and policies penned by the KCR regime. On one hand, there is a discussion on the remarks made by TRS MLA Abraham regarding the early elections, on the other hand, TPCC chief Rewanth Reddy dropped some sensational comments on the same. Abraham was recently quoted saying that KCR will dissolve the assembly in December and go for early elections in March. Speaking about this, aggravated Revanth Reddy said that the days are near for KCR. He made these remarks while participating in the Medchal constituency membership registration drive.
Revanth said that if Congress comes to power, the party workers will be the first priority. He urged the people to sign up for the memberships at the fullest in their respective constituencies. Revanth was seen saying that he will bring Sonia Gandhi to the kingdom of Telangana when he comes to power. He promised on implementing all the promised schemes. Also, assured that the houses and pensions would be given to the poor on time.
In addition, Revanth urged the people to not miss out on membership registration. He spoke about how important is each and every registration. He revealed that the Medchal Assembly constituency is currently in the second position in terms of membership registration. He said that the active membership of the Congress in Telangana has reached 40 lakhs.
Talking further about the registration drive, Revanth revealed that he promised the party president Sonia Gandhi that he can assure 30 lakh members, but with the efforts of everyone in the party, 40 lakh members had already been registered. He added that he aims to gain 50 lakh active memberships and prove to Sonia Gandhi that Telangana is supporting congress at its best. Revanth assured the party workers of recognition from superiors and benefits after winning the elections. He said that the real heroes in Congress are the activists, and everyone who worked for the welfare of the party will definitely get their due respect.
